Alysa Liu might have interview fatigue — understandably so!
The 20-year-old American figure skater is fresh off of a spectacular Olympics run, during which she secured two gold medals, becoming the first U.S. woman to win two golds at a single Olympic Games.
She brought those very medals to an appearance on TODAY Monday, March 2, during which she had a bit of an unexpected reaction to a question from co-anchor Dylan Dreyer.
After the NBC meteorologist read out loud a supposed letter that a younger Alysa had written to her future self, she couldn’t help but ask: “I wrote that? When? Where?” noting with a laugh it was her first time seeing it.
And though she didn’t recall her words — it was a 2019 letter she, as well as gold medalist hockey Player Jack Hughes, wrote for ESPN — she did have an incredibly thoughtful answer when asked what she would tell her younger self, simply declaring “nothing.”
“Nothing, she’s got it, she’ll figure it out, she’ll go through it and I don’t want to mess that up,” she emphasized.
